Accessibility standards
This website aims to conform to the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) 2.1 at Level AA. These guidelines explain how to make web content more accessible for people with disabilities and more user-friendly for everyone.
What we do to ensure accessibility
We work to ensure that our website:
Can be navigated using a keyboard
Works with screen readers and other assistive technologies
Uses sufficient colour contrast for text and interactive elements
Provides text alternatives for non-text content
Uses clear, simple language
Functions across different browsers and devices
